EFTPOS Gaining Traction

Small businesses are increasingly adopting to digital payment methods, with EFTPOS systems seeing a significant climb. This shift is driven by several factors, including increasing consumer demand for contactless payments, the simplicity of processing transactions electronically, and the potential for enhanced financial management.

For small businesses, EFTPOS offers a number of perks. It accelerates the checkout process, reducing wait times and improving customer satisfaction. Moreover, EFTPOS systems can integrate with more info accounting software, providing valuable data for analyzing income and expenses.

Finally, the security provided by modern EFTPOS systems offers peace of mind for both businesses and customers.

The Australian Cashless Evolution: Trends and Predictions

Australia is undergoing a significant shift towards a cashless society. Driven by growing consumer preference for digital payment options, the implementation of contactless and mobile payment platforms is rapidly expanding.

This phenomenon is fueled by a number of factors, including the ease of digital payments, boosted security features, and the ubiquitous availability of smartphones.

As Australia integrates this cashless future, numerous predictions emerge. One key prediction is a further reduction in the use of physical cash, with online transactions growing into the prevailing mode of payment.

Additionally, this evolution is expected to have a significant impact on various sectors, such as retail, finance, and government services. The landscape of payments is rapidly evolving, and Australia stands at the tip of the spear of this global trend.

From Pouches to Waves: Navigating the Australian Cashless Revolution

Australia is rapidly embracing a cashless society, with digital payments soaring in popularity. This shift results in a multitude of factors, including the ease of online transactions and growing concerns about security associated with tangible cash. From everyday purchases to complex economic transactions, Australians are increasingly relying on digital platforms for their diverse requirements. This transformation presents both advantages and obstacles that need to be carefully considered.

  • The rise of electronic banking has altered the way Australians handle their money.
  • Nevertheless, there are concerns about economic exclusion and the potential impact on vulnerable groups of society.
  • Governments and businesses are working to address these obstacles and ensure a smooth transition to a cashless future.
